We love the complexity as it is a Bordeaux style blend with Cabernet, Merlot and Cab Franc. The 2012 was about 60% Cab. We were at a special winemaker dinner where we tasted the 2012 and unreleased 2013 side by side. The 2013 is 75% cab. Full fruit and very balanced. The 2013 was very tight when it was poured, but did start to open up in the glass. It does need a bit more time in the bottle, but I think while the 2012 was absolutely wonderful, the 2013 will surpass it once it is ready. Amizetta is one of our favorite wineries in Napa.
